Gilder Lehrman Collection #: GLC01620 Author/Creator: Stanford, Leland (1824-1893) Place Written: Sacramento, California Type: Document signed Date: 6 March 1863 Pagination: 2 p. : vellum ; 62 x 46 cm. Order a Copy

Partially printed document signed by Stanford as Governor of California and countersigned by California Secretary of State William H. Weeks, Adjutant General William Kibbe, and Deputy A.A.H. Tuttle. Sealed with the Great Seal of California (with bear, Minerva and gold-digger). With partially printed oath of allegiance signed by Witham on verso, dated May 16 at Stockton, California.
